Monopole Percolation in pure gauge compact QED

Abstract

The role of monopoles in quenched compact QED has been studied by measuring the cluster susceptibility and the order parameter nmax/ntot previously introduced by Hands and Wensley in the study of the percolation transition observed in non-compact QED. A correlation between these parameters and the energy (action) at the phase transition has been observed. We conclude that the order parameter nmax/ntot is a sensitive probe for studying the phase transition of pure gauge compact QED.
